Object prototype modification via unsafe recursive merge
Published Dec 10, 2021 · Updated Sep 16, 2024
Prototype pollution in all versions of Eser Ozvataf Sey allows remote attackers to modify inherited object properties via crafted merge input. The deepmerge() function recursively follows a source object's prototype property and copies attacker-controlled values into Object.prototype without rejecting special keys. Reachability requires a consuming application to pass attacker-controlled objects into deepmerge(); successful exploitation changes properties inherited within that Node.js process.
